    Major Duties, Responsibilities

    Dental Assistant I:
    • Prepares materials and tray set up to assist dentist during dental procedures. Sterilizes and disinfects instruments. Prepares and cleans operatory.
    • Records and reviews patients' medical and dental histories. Monitors patients during dental procedures. Provides postoperative instructions prescribed by dentist.
    • Performs clerical duties that include answering telephones, scheduling appointments, and processing messages and filing documents into the electronic dental record.
    • Maintains the stock of supplies and materials. Processes diagnostic x rays
    • Performs other job-related duties as assigned.
    Dental Assistant II:
    • Prepares materials and tray set up to assist dentist during dental procedures. Sterilizes and disinfects instruments. Prepares and cleans operatory.
    • Records and reviews patients' medical and dental histories. Monitors patients during dental procedures. Provides postoperative instructions prescribed by dentist.
    • Performs clerical duties that include answering telephones, scheduling appointments, and processing messages and filing documents into the electronic dental record.
    • Maintains the stock of supplies and materials.
    • Processes diagnostic x rays.
    • Takes preliminary alginate impressions for study models. Pours and trims study models.
    • Performs other job-related duties as assigned.


    Minimum Qualifications

    Dental Assistant I:
    Education:
    High school diploma or equivalent.
    Experience:
    No experience required.
    Additional Requirements:
    Must possess Basic Life Support for the Health Care Professional within three (3) months of hire.
    Must obtain X-Ray certification within one (1) year of hire.
    Must possess a valid Arizona driver’s license.
    Must possess a current fingerprint clearance card Issued by the Arizona Department of Public Safety.

    Dental Assistant II:
    Education:
    High school diploma or equivalent.
    Experience:
    A minimum of two (2) years of experience as a dental assistant.
    Additional Requirements:
    Must possess Dental X-Ray License.
    Must possess Basic Life Support for the Health Care Professional.
    Must possess a valid Arizona driver’s license.
    Must possess a current fingerprint clearance card Issued by the Arizona Department of Public Safety.

    Yavapai County is in northcentral Arizona, just north of Phoenix, and is one of the four original Arizona counties formed in 1864.  The County, with approximately 246,191 residents, includes eight incorporated towns and cities:  Prescott (county seat), Prescott Valley, Chino Valley, Jerome, Clarkdale, Sedona, Cottonwood, Camp Verde, and the newest municipality Dewey-Humboldt.  The County features some of the most spectacular natural beauty in the American West with a mild climate, four beautiful and distinct seasons, and breathtaking landscapes complete with granite mountains, lakes, and rolling meadows.
